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68990504 0557 9978592073
1114839702 66839543
1114839702 66839543
27 738683 1298 7125225 497843068
All about undefined
Interested in learning more?
1114839702 66839543
27 738683 1298 7125225 497843068
See more
5386 6984415
109986 0717 28412510
See more
385630991 6691 42906
53743352600 414 9962760976
See more